The Club
Centrally situated in the West End of Aberdeen, the Club's present building is
of special architectural interest and has been refurbished to an extremely high
standard. This level of decoration has been continued in the new extension, which
was completed in the autumn of 1994.
Facilities include a Members' Bar, Smokeroom, Library, Billiard Room and Dining
Room, the elegant Reynolds' Room, the new Garden Room, Television Room and a
total of eleven bedrooms.

| Facilities at the Club |
|
Facilities at the Club fulfil the original ideals of the founder members to provide
'a home away from home' where members can dine, relax or entertain friends and
colleagues in a warm and dignified atmosphere.
The Club's busy social calendar also provides many opportunities for members to
sample food and wine from around the world. The Club's private rooms include the
Bar and Smoking Room where members and guests can enjoy a leisurely drink before
lunch or dinner while the Library and Television Room provide a quiet and undisturbed
atmosphere for members to catch up on the news through all manner of newspapers
and journals.
The Billiard Room is popular with many members, especially after
Club functions and dinners, and is the venue for the annual Snooker Quaich competition.
The Library and Reynolds' Room are available to members and out
of town visitors for business meetings and private seminars. Audio visual and
conference facilities are available.
The Club provides pleasant, spacious and inexpensive accommodation within walking
distance of the city centre. Bedrooms have private bathrooms, telephone, television,
Cable television, radio and tea and coffee making facilities.
